Advisor, Marketing Communications

2 weeks ago


Montréal QC, Canada Business Development Bank of Canada Full time

We are banking at another level.

Choosing BDC as your employer means working in a healthy, inclusive, and skilled workplace that puts forward the best conditions to bring together unique teams where employees are empowered to act. It also means being at the centre of ambitious economic and financial projects to see further and to do things differently, to fuel the success of Canadian entrepreneurs.

Choosing BDC as your employer also means:
- Flexible and competitive benefits, including an Employee Savings and Investment Plan where BDC matches part of your voluntary contributions, a Defined Benefit Pension Plan, a $750 wellness and health care spending account, to name a few- In addition to paid vacation each year, five personal days, sick days as necessary, and our offices are closed from December 25 to January 1- A hybrid work model that truly balances work and personal life- Opportunities for learning, training and development, and much more...
- _Please note that this role is temporary for 6 months._

POSITION OVERVIEW

The Advisor, Marketing Communications, creates marketing communication assets for multiple channels to support sales and to increases awareness of BDC’s products and services. He/she provides marketing guidance to colleagues in the lines of businesses and regions.

CHALLENGES TO BE MET- Act as a marketing project lead and work closely with business units and regions to create and develop communications tactics and marketing tools to promote or launch products and initiatives.- Contribute to the planning of integrated campaigns as part of a cross-functional team.- Write marketing briefs to orient the development of marketing communications assets.- Be a contributor of BDC’s marketing content development and ensure its alignment across all channels, by using and enforcing the approach and style guide.- Ensure that the most relevant marketing tools are available, and that their content is updated frequently.- Ensure consistency of brand positioning and messages in all communications.

WHAT WE ARE LOOKING FOR- Bachelor’s degree in marketing, communications, journalism, or any related field- Minimum of five years of experience in writing and editing business marketing and communications materials- Experience in creating marketing briefs and plans as well as launching products- Fluently bilingual written and spoken (English and French)- Excellent written communication skills (English and French)- Ability to create engaging and convincing marketing communications- Strong ability to position a message/narrative and to influence others- Good team player and talented negotiator- A successful track record of launching products and campaigns- Excellent organizational skills and ability to manage several projects simultaneously- Autonomous, excellent judgment and initiative- Good knowledge of the small business environment
- _Please take note that temporary employees are not eligible for benefits._

.


  • Advisor, Marketing

    2 weeks ago


    Montréal, QC, Canada Desjardins Full time

    Temporary position for 18 months As a marketing advisor, you help develop and update the organization’s products and services to meet member/client needs and support business development. You analyze market needs and develop and implement product and service marketing strategies. You serve as resource person to clients and partners and advise and assist...


  • Montréal, QC, Canada Belron Canada Full time

    Automotive glass technology is helping transform how we experience the road. At Belron Canada, the home office of Speedy Glass, Lebeau vitres d’auto and Vanfax we take this seriously, which is why we invest tirelessly on developing our people can realize their full potential. Your role at a glance - The Advisor, Pricing, Commercial Strategy & Market...


  • Montréal, QC, Canada Desjardins Full time

    As a marketing advisor, you help develop and update the organization’s products and services to meet member/client needs and support business development. You analyze market needs and develop and implement product and service marketing strategies. You serve as resource person to clients and partners and advise and assist them on important development...

  • Marketing Advisor

    4 days ago


    Montréal, Canada Createch Full time

    Company Description Createch, a Talan company is a Canadian leader in operational performance improvement, supply chain optimization and in the integration of information technology solutions. Since 1993, we offer services in manufacturing and logistics performance improvement, process reengineering, change management and ERP solution implementation. The...


  • Montréal, Canada Cogeco Communications Inc. Full time

    Our culture lifts you up—there is no ego in the way. Our common purpose? We all want to win for our customers. We aim to always be evolving, dynamic, and ambitious. We believe in the power of genuine connections. Each employee is a part of what makes us unique on the market: agile and dedicated. Time Type: Regular Job Description: Please refer to French...


  • Montréal, Canada RML- Richter Management Ltd -Main Full time

    We are seeking an individual who is willing to present new ideas and fresh thinking when it comes to the execution of communication plans, print and digital material, employee engagement and special projects. **Responsibilities**: Our Communications Advisor, will shape and create content, ensuring tone of voice and style are consistent with the Richter...

  • Advisor, Marketing

    2 weeks ago


    Montréal, Canada Desjardins Full time

    As a marketing advisor, you help develop and update the organization’s products and services to meet member/client needs and support business development. You analyze market needs and develop and implement product and service marketing strategies. You serve as resource person to clients and partners and advise and assist them on important development...


  • Montréal, Canada Sii Full time

    Partenaire technologique des grandes entreprises depuis 1979, le Groupe SII est au cœur de l'économie de l'innovation avec 10 000 collaborateurs, une présence internationale dans 20 pays, et un chiffre d’affaires supérieur à 520 millions de dollars canadiens. SII Canada, installée à Montréal et Toronto, a pour objectif d'apporter des solutions à...


  • Montréal, Canada SII Technologies GmbH HR-Service Full time

    Partenaire technologique des grandes entreprises depuis 1979, le Groupe SII est au cœur de l'économie de l'innovation avec 10 000 collaborateurs, une présence internationale dans 20 pays, et un chiffre d’affaires supérieur à 520 millions de dollars canadiens. SII Canada, installée à Montréal et Toronto, a pour objectif d'apporter des solutions à...

  • Advisor, Marketing

    2 weeks ago


    Montréal, Canada Desjardins Full time

    Temporary position for 12 months. As a marketing advisor, you help develop and update the organization’s products and services to meet member/client needs and support business development. You analyze market needs and develop and implement product and service marketing strategies. You serve as resource person to clients and partners and advise and assist...